What Matters Now: Take Time to Reflect

I was fortunate today that I changed my view on Facebook to "Pages". As I scrolled down the list, I came across a post from Seth Godin's blog describing a new FREE ebook called What Matters Now. It contains brief but compelling ideas from over 70 big thinkers (Elizabeth Gilbert, Jacqueline Novogratz, Guy Kawasaki).


The ebook includes many simple truths, plus several ideas to make you go "hmmmmm ..." as you reflect on 2009 and prepare for the New Year. I'm taking on Seth's challenge to help spread these ideas to 5 million people.

I'm only half-way through the ebook, but thought I'd share my TOP 3 Ideas so far:
  1. EASE: Even as a stress management coach, I can chuckle at Elizabeth Gilbert's suggestion to make time to "meditate but secretly nap" to ease off the gas and build in some "me-time." I can't be mad at her because sleep is SO important, and is also rejuvenating for your soul.
  2. 1%: Jackie Huba and Ben McConnell talk about the "One Percenters" -- the small group of folks who spread the word about new ideas, trends and concepts. Even as a vegetarian, I had to love the "Bacon Salt" story that spread like ... porkbellies? My question to YOU is: Who will be YOUR One Percenters in 2010? In my career and business coaching sessions, I've called these people your champions -- those people who will go the extra mile to create a buzz about your talents and accomplishments.
  3. UN-Sustainability: Given that my mission involves helping people achieve sustainable results, I was particularly intrigued by Alan Webber's flipping of the script. He suggests we identify and un-mask the UN-sustainable systems that "represent the dead weight of the past." From this essay, my question to YOU is: What will be UN-sustainable for you in 2010? What dead weight do you plan to lose?

Professional Holiday Parties - Tips to Help You to Shine

As the holiday season is now upon us, it seems timely to share some tips and ideas to help you navigate the professional holiday party scene. As I have shared many of these tips before, I thought I'd encourage you to (re)review my blog post: Tis the Season to be Jolly ... NOT for Career Folly.


You'll notice that the post was written in December 2005 (yes, I've been blogging for over four years now!). I think the tips are still appropriate; what do you think?

In today's economy, I'd probably add a few more suggestions:
  • Determine which of the events will give you your "biggest bang for the buck." You'll want to budget for holiday events just as you would any other networking events. Survey all of the events in your area that interest you, and prioritize them in order of relevance to your 2010 personal/professional goals. Perhaps one well-selected "high-ticket" event will expand your network more than several lower cost ones.
  • Be a connector – help others to meet relevant contacts in your network. Networking is also about what you can give -- and, 'tis the season to give! If people see you as someone who is helpful, they’ll be more likely to help you. This relates to my next tip ...
  • Be conscientious about your follow-up. LISTEN more than you're speaking when you meet new people. Take note of their interests and goals. For those people with whom you'd like to stay in contact, make time to share information that would be helpful or interesting to them.
  • When someone asks, “What’s new?” be prepared with an answer that might make someone say "WOW!" We all have experienced some challenges this year; and yet, inspiring stories are always good to hear. This might require some additional thought -- think of the good things that have happened this year; think of the positive people in your support circle; think of the small wins you've already achieved. I'm confident you can come up with a couple of ideas.
